Property Description
This exquisite, custom 5 bedroom, 2.5 bath home, is located on a .89-acre parcel in the most coveted Wild Quail Golf and Country Club Community, as well as in one of Kent County's most desirable neighborhoods. Within the community is the championship Wild Quail golf course and clubhouse, which offers its members course access, fine and casual dining, tennis and pickleball located within the Caesar Rodney School District. Within a 15 minute drive, there are Delaware Tech and Delaware State University, Delaware's Capital "Dover", Bayhealth Medical, The Dover Air Force Base, Dover Downs Raceway and Casino and numerous great hotels. Wonderful restaurants and lots of shopping are also within a short drive. Don't forget the award-winning Delaware Beaches which are within an hour's drive. The home is situated on a premier corner lot with the golf course running alongside and behind it, as well as some dense trees for privacy while resting out on the composite deck or within the 3-Season Room. The curb appeal is through the roof with the 4 stately, 2-story columns that support a magnificent large front porch giving way to extraordinary views. The property has a paver driveway and walkway, multi-zoned irrigation system which draws water from a well, therefore no associated water bill, is freshly mulched & boasts mature landscaping. Some additional features and updates of this very impressive home include: A 2-story entrance foyer with high ceilings, recessed lighting, crown trim & random width hardwood flooring throughout the main level. The main level master bedroom with a master bath includes step-in shower, separate tub, and custom walk-in closet. There is a separate but adjoining, dual purpose master sitting area or Study/Den which can be accessed from the foyer or the master bedroom. The main level also has a formal Living room and Dining room with crown molding and tall windows. The huge eat-in, gourmet kitchen has lots of cabinet and quartz countertop space, oversized island, subway tile backsplash, stainless steel appliances, deep stainless-steel sink, range with double ovens, a breakfast area, recessed lighting, and a pantry. The main level laundry features shelving, and the high-capacity washer and dryer are included. Both the mud room and laundry are conveniently located within the floor plan. The very tastefully decorated step-down family room has a vaulted ceiling, built-in shelving, floor to ceiling brick wood burning fireplace which is flanked by windows allowing for additional natural light. Enjoy your coffee in the 3-season room which leads to the rear composite deck and hot tub. It has 2 ceiling fans and can be accessed from the family room and kitchen. The updated powder room rounds off the main level. The upper-level houses 4 very nicely sized bedrooms, all with generous closet space. Numerous windows for wonderful views of the golf course and of the nearby executive custom homes. There is an updated full bath with a skylight, double bowl sink and shower/deep soaking tub. The partially finished basement has a rec room as well as storage. There is a 2-car garage with high ceilings for those who would like a car lift and extra storage. A few more updates include: New roof and Septic in 2020, Security cameras, irrigation and well system in 2021 with 5 zones, and a new garage door in 2023. New stainless steel chimney cap, chimney crown and chimney cleaning in 2021. Carpet cleaning of the upper-level bedrooms and air duct cleaning in November 2023. Septic system cleaning in December 2023. Home power washed in February 2024.

HUD Foreclosures

HUD foreclosures and VA Foreclosures are some of the best homes to buy when price is part of the equation. As with most Americans, price is always a concern. If not buying the same house for less, why not buy more house for the same dollar invested? When looking for a good deal it is hard to do better than the VA or HUD foreclosures market. The simple truth is that there are just more VA and HUD homes on the market, as they represent such a large number of mortgages that are generated each year. This translates into more foreclosures just by the magnitude of difference between all others comparing to the two largest. The two largest also being government owned and operated means that they have less time to wait to make money back on the home. The FHA is especially known for selling HUD homes for less than the average sales price in a given area. FHA foreclosures represent a fraction of HUD but they are still a significant number of homes and both should be considered. VA (Veterans Administration) and HUD (Housing and Urban Development) have different and unique opportunities for the buyer. Both are often forgiven for the local taxes normally associated with the purchase of a home (this is on a county by county basis). Be sure to ask the local title company or escrow company to look into it for you before closing as this is often missed due to their are not used to dealing with the 2 to 3 percent of the market that VA and HUD foreclosures represent.

Foreclosure Listings Increasing

As the market settled after the mortgage meltdown foreclosure listings also settled and fewer homes were on the market with a placard reading “Bank Foreclosure” in big red lettering. This was a good thing for the entire real estate market. Having an abundance of foreclosures brings the entire market down and it makes it harder for home owners, who would like to move, to get the appropriate price for their home as a similar home down the same street was sold for substantially less and the appraiser is using the foreclosure as a comparable sale. This is just one of the problems when there are too many foreclosure listings in any area. Another issue is the television set that sits in everyone’s living room harping about the price of homes based on the number of foreclosures and this constant barrage of negative information makes most people sit on the sidelines waiting for the market to either implode completely or to correct itself. Meanwhile while they wait, others are buying foreclosure listings and making great investments. Whatever the reason, a market can only handle so many foreclosure listings at any given time. The more foreclosures, the lower the market gets and this is a lesson the banks that were foreclosing and selling off realized too late. The market and their investments would have been better off if there had not been a rush to divest themselves of the toxic assets made more toxic by their own actions.
